An Infrared System is special equipment used in conference interpretation and meetings where people speak different languages. It works like a wireless TV remote but for language interpretation. The interpreter speaks into a microphone in a booth, and their translation is sent through invisible infrared light to small receivers that attendees wear. People can then listen to the translation in their preferred language through headphones. This technology is common in international conferences, United Nations meetings, and multilingual events. Similar systems include radio frequency (RF) systems or tour guide systems, but infrared is preferred in many professional settings because it's more secure and doesn't interfere with other electronic equipment.

Q: How would you handle equipment failure during a high-profile international conference?
Expected Answer: Should explain backup systems, quick troubleshooting procedures, and having spare equipment ready. Should mention communication protocols with clients and interpreters during technical issues.
Q: Describe your experience in planning large-scale interpretation setups for multiple languages.
Expected Answer: Should discuss room layout planning, calculating required number of receivers, booth placement, and coordination with multiple interpreters and technical staff.
Q: What are the key maintenance procedures for infrared interpretation equipment?
Expected Answer: Should describe regular testing, cleaning procedures, battery management, and preventive maintenance schedules.
Q: How do you ensure proper coverage in rooms with challenging layouts?
Expected Answer: Should explain radiator placement strategies, signal testing, and solutions for rooms with pillars or unusual shapes.
Q: What are the basic components of an infrared interpretation system?
Expected Answer: Should identify main parts: transmitters, radiators, receivers, interpreter consoles, and headphones, and explain their basic functions.
Q: How do you distribute and collect receivers while keeping track of them?
Expected Answer: Should explain basic inventory management, sign-out procedures, and end-of-event collection methods.
